  • Reviewed: 16 May 2024

    9.0
    We would recommend the Holiday Inn Express Bristol. Good value for money and a superb location.
    • Leisure trip
    • Family with young children
    • Twin Room
    • Stayed 2 nights

    There wasn't anything we didn't like about the hotel

    The location of the hotel will suit people using public transport. The hotel is just a short walk from the train station. Also just outside the train station there are a number of buses giving easy access to the main tourist attractions and the city centre. Because of the train strikes we arrived early and the friendly reception staff were kind enough to store our luggage. leaving us free to visit the Clifton Suspension Bridge before check-in. Our twin room was clean and very comfortable with complimentary toiletries and tea and coffee making facilities. which is always appreciated. There was a note in the bathroom, offering complementary additional toiletries if guests had forgotten something. I thought that was a lovely touch and reflected the kind and friendly atmosphere. We stayed Bed and Breakfast for two nights. The buffet breakfasts were very good and plenty of choice.
